凌晨五点,米兰大教堂前的广场还没被游客占领。我系紧鞋带,点击手机屏幕上“NGSK游记模式”的开关。那一分钟,软件用0.3秒识别了我的鞋底触地频率,然后跳出提示:“当前踏频180步/分钟,大教堂区域的回弹力偏软,建议调整前掌落地的角度。”我不是在跑步——我在生成攻略。两个月后,当我朋友拿着普通跑步App的轨迹图问我“米兰去哪儿跑”时,我直接把这条由一双鞋一座城NGSK游记自动导出的路线发过去。“自己看,连每段路面的软硬都有评级。”
这不是噱头。米兰体育官网推出的这款CN旅行指南,核心逻辑极其简单:把每一双鞋踩过的路面,变成可复用的攻略数据。当前版本v2.0.5已经能完成三件事——同步赛程数据、采集地面触感、生成分段推荐。2019年我在大理试过类似功能,那时数据量不够,跑完5公里,系统只记得我的配速。现在不一样了:从米兰大教堂出发,经过斯福尔扎城堡,穿过布雷拉街区的鹅卵石路,最后在运河区结束——5.8公里路程,系统自动标注出3个危险点(湿滑青苔区、松动石砖区、高压井盖区),以及2个适合间歇跑的硬质地段。这些数据哪怕从跑步App里导一个月也导不出来,因为它不记录“路面触觉”,只记录轨迹和心率。
赌输的人都在滑倒,赌赢的人不用手机
林骁在NGSK用户群里分享过他在米兰斯卡拉歌剧院附近的翻车经历。他用普通运动手表跟着地图随意跑,结果踩上一块沾了露水的大理石板,右膝直接跪地。休养了三周。“那双鞋一座城NGSK游记的赛程数据如果把那种路段标成警示,我肯定避开。”他把那次教训变成了一条8.2公里的新路线,标记出最“杀膝盖”的5个拐角。那条路线后来被后台引用为经典模板,直接纳入了官方赛程数据库。
踩缝纫机一样的气垫跑鞋、赤足五指鞋、厚底碳板鞋——v2.0.5的数据库里录入了14种鞋型的触地反馈模板。走在维托里奥·埃马努埃莱二世拱廊街,塑料底的皮鞋会打滑,越野跑的钉鞋会伤到古砖。你用一双鞋一座城NGSK游记模式行走时,系统会根据鞋底参数,动态提醒“请减速”“请靠路边走”。这是一个跑过六座城市的老玩家的原话:“普通地图告诉你路在哪,它告诉你路怎么疼才不疼。”
每一座城,都是踩出来的独家地图
两个月前我用它跑哥本哈根。出机场定位后,系统直接弹出一个选项:“有哥本哈根马拉松上午赛程数据,是否关联你的个人行进数据?”我点了是。半程下来,系统把“斜坡配速降速”这个点自动转化成了新的策略备注。等我回米兰用同样的模式比对数据时,发现米兰赛道居然不支持类似计算——因为米兰起伏少,坡度补偿算法没法精准适配。这让我明白一件事:不同城市的CN旅行指南,本质是在做“鞋底方言翻译”。上海的梧桐区路侧微湿要防滑,洛杉矶的柏油路高温要隔热,米兰的古街道要防砖缝夹脚。一双鞋一座城NGSK游记的赛程数据本质是把城市看成一台有节奏的机器——你不是踩过去,而是跟地面的频率做切换。
上周在布雷拉画展附近的石板路上,我刚跑了300米,耳机里NGSK突然叫停:“前方26米处有一块已下陷的石板,深度3厘米,请绕行。”我放慢速度,果然看见一块明显沉降的灰黑色地砖——换作别的App,它会把这当成一段平坦路径。没有反馈的数据,只是路线的骨架;而有触觉反馈的轨迹,才是路面的肉身。这就是一双鞋一座城MILAN攻略真正的信息密度所在。
跑完一组间歇后,我停在水渠旁的台阶上,打开后台的回看模式。系统自动输出一个数字:“你在这段路面触发了落地翻转修正曲线,和GNC赛程数据库编号375在悉尼歌剧院的轨迹逻辑一致。”我愣了一下。这意味着不同大洲、完全不同的地砖,在NGSK的计算逻辑下居然能归类为同一种“跑感”。不是城市一样,而是鞋底接触的姿态训练记忆相通。那一刻我确信,所谓“用一双鞋走过一座城”,不是在追异域的地标,而是让鞋底提取相同的振动方程——城市只是表面,节奏才是内核。
用一双鞋一座城NGSK游记收尾的标准不是完成了多少公里,而是你踩过的那些陌生街道,终于能裸眼识别出松动的砖在哪一条线上,碎过自己哪一次落地。
